Today, I had to pick up some documents from a colleague who lives very close to the Sintra Mountains. On a particularly cold day in Portugal, with lots of rain, I was lucky that there wasn't much traffic, as it's not a very inviting time for tourists...

Although tourism in Sintra does not suffer much from bad weather. Demand is so high that it sometimes does not slow down even in the coldest and darkest months of winter.

A severe weather warning was issued for today, and despite the warnings of heavy rain, there were still periods during the afternoon when the clouds cleared, and the sun timidly appeared and almost warmed the skin...

In Sintra, temperatures are never very high, and it is always significantly colder and windier than in the towns closer to central Lisbon.

Sintra is a fantastic place, and today, as I only had a few minutes to walk from where I left my car to my friend's house, I didn't get to explore much. Although the temperature was around 8ºC, it certainly felt colder. So, the conditions were not right for me to explore a little more of this fantastic historic town in my country.

If you ever have the opportunity to visit Portugal, Sintra is definitely one of the places you should consider spending a day of your stay to get to know. And I guarantee that there will be plenty, but really plenty, for you to see on a second and third visit.

Here are some photos I took today, very close to the Sintra Municipal Market, which had already closed by the time I arrived. I also passed by the entrance to the Sintra Museum of Art, which, despite being open, I didn't have time to visit as I was pressed for time.

At the end, I still had the opportunity to see the Moorish Castle.
One of the best views from here.
